When choosing a protein powder, it's important to consider the source of the protein. Common sources include whey, casein, soy, pea, and brown rice. Each source has its own unique benefits and drawbacks in terms of digestibility, amino acid profile, and allergenicity. Vanilla protein powders often contain added sweeteners, flavors, and stabilizers to enhance taste and texture. Therefore, carefully examining the ingredient list is crucial to ensure the product aligns with your dietary preferences and health goals. For instance, if you're lactose intolerant, you'll want to avoid whey-based powders. Similarly, if you're following a vegan diet, you'll need to opt for plant-based options like soy or pea protein. Always read the label thoroughly to make an informed decision.
Moreover, the quality of the protein powder can vary significantly between brands. Look for products that have undergone third-party testing to verify their purity and potency. This ensures that you're getting what the label claims, without any hidden additives or contaminants. Mixability: Nobody likes a chunky protein shake! A good protein powder should dissolve easily in water, milk, or other liquids without leaving clumps or residue. The mixability of a protein powder depends on several factors, including the protein source, the particle size, and the presence of additives. Whey protein isolate, for example, tends to mix more easily than casein protein. Similarly, protein powders with smaller particle sizes generally dissolve more readily. To improve mixability, try using a shaker bottle with a wire whisk ball or a blender. These tools can help break up any clumps and ensure a smooth, consistent shake. Also, be sure to add the liquid to the shaker bottle before adding the protein powder. This can help prevent the powder from clumping at the bottom.

- Protein Content: The amount of protein per serving is a primary factor. Look for a product that provides a substantial amount of protein, typically around 20-30 grams per scoop. This will help you meet your daily protein needs and support muscle growth and recovery.
- Amino Acid Profile: Check if the protein source contains a complete amino acid profile, meaning it includes all nine essential amino acids. These are the amino acids that your body cannot produce on its own and must obtain from food. A complete amino acid profile is crucial for muscle protein synthesis and overall health.
- Carbohydrates and Fats: Pay attention to the carbohydrate and fat content per serving. If you're following a low-carb or low-fat diet, you'll want to choose a protein powder that aligns with your macronutrient goals. Some protein powders may contain added sugars or unhealthy fats, so be sure to read the label carefully.
- Added Sugars and Sweeteners: Be mindful of the types of sweeteners used in the protein powder. Opt for products that use natural sweeteners like stevia, monk fruit, or erythritol, and avoid those with excessive amounts of added sugars or artificial sweeteners.
- Other Ingredients: Scrutinize the ingredient list for any potential allergens, additives, or fillers. Common allergens include dairy, soy, and gluten. If you have any sensitivities or dietary restrictions, make sure the protein powder is free from these ingredients. Also, be wary of products that contain excessive amounts of artificial colors, flavors, or preservatives. These additives can sometimes cause digestive issues or other adverse reactions.
